IP查询
查询
你查询的IP:[114.80.224.111] 地理位置:中国–上海–上海电信/IDC机房
最新查询
119.78.79.212
122.48.199.243
218.12.5.184
117.100.254.225
119.40.107.25
119.205.192.18
114.68.227.197
219.244.58.30
123.184.29.98
114.80.224.111
125.98.118.164
210.22.82.98
118.132.227.176
202.124.24.42
211.136.190.206
203.100.192.103
218.108.149.30
59.64.167.66
210.82.26.167
118.184.252.110
124.112.85.117
211.80.47.166
123.138.92.151
124.88.159.213
218.108.64.229
221.8.106.239
202.38.158.143
210.12.104.40
210.76.10.85
123.138.3.57
202.43.144.115